<h3>Function And Application</h3>
<p>The side impact sensor monitors lateral acceleration and sends a signal to the airbag control unit when a significant side collision is detected. Its role is critical for triggering side and curtain airbags at the correct time during an impact. These sensors are typically mounted in the B‑pillar, door area, or lower body shell depending on the model and must be installed with correct orientation and secure electrical connections to work reliably.</p>

<h3>Replacement Procedure</h3>
<ul>
<li>Disconnect the vehicle battery and wait at least 2–10 minutes to allow the airbag system capacitors to discharge (follow vehicle manufacturer recommendations).</li>
<li>Access the sensor by removing interior trim panels in the B‑pillar or door area; keep fasteners and clips for reinstallation.</li>
<li>Unplug the electrical connector and remove the sensor mounting screws or bolts.</li>
<li>Fit the new sensor in the correct orientation, secure fasteners without over‑tightening, and reconnect the electrical connector.</li>
<li>Reconnect the battery and perform a diagnostic scan. Clear any crash codes and confirm communication between the sensor and the airbag control module.</li>
</ul>

<h3>Most Common Cause Of Failure</h3>
<p>Side impact sensors normally last the life of the vehicle but can fail after a collision, from water ingress, corrosion, connector damage, or mechanical shock. Faulty wiring, poor grounding or long‑term exposure to moisture are common contributors. After an accident the sensor may be mechanically damaged or its calibration lost, requiring replacement and diagnostic reset.</p>

<h3>Function And Fitment</h3>
<p>The side impact (lateral) sensor is an acceleration sensor dedicated to detecting rapid lateral deceleration. It communicates directly with the vehicle&#8217;s airbag control unit to permit timely deployment of side-impact protection. Typical mounting locations are the B‑pillar inner structure, door inner panel, or seat rail area depending on model and year. Correct orientation and secure mechanical fixation are essential for reliable operation.</p>
<h3>Common Failure Causes</h3>
<ul>
<li>Physical damage from previous collisions—impacts can deform or damage the sensor housing or mounting points.</li>
<li>Connector corrosion or wiring faults—moisture ingress or abrasion may interrupt the signal path.</li>
<li>Water ingress—especially on units mounted in door areas or lower pillars, leading to electrical shorting or internal corrosion.</li>
<li>Incorrect handling during repairs—improper removal or impact to the sensor can alter calibration or break internal components.</li>
<li>Rarely, electronic component failure due to age or manufacturing defects.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Installation Recommendations</h3>
<ul>
<li>Always Disconnect The Battery Before Work: Remove the negative terminal and wait at least two minutes (or follow the vehicle manufacturer&#8217;s specified delay) to ensure the airbag system is de‑energized.</li>
<li>Preserve Sensor Orientation: Install the replacement with the same orientation and mounting position as the original—incorrect alignment can prevent correct triggering.</li>
<li>Use Correct Fasteners And Torque: Secure the sensor to factory torque values where available; avoid over‑tightening which can damage the housing.</li>
<li>Inspect Wiring And Connectors: Clean or replace corroded connectors and repair damaged wiring to restore reliable communication with the airbag control unit.</li>
<li>Clear And Verify Fault Codes: After installation, clear airbag system fault codes and perform a diagnostic check with a suitable scanner to confirm system readiness. If warning lights persist, diagnose further before returning the vehicle to service.</li>
<li>Safety Note: Airbag system work can be hazardous. If unsure, have installation and verification performed by a qualified technician with appropriate diagnostic equipment.</li>
</ul>
